What are the treatments for lung tumors

What are the treatments for lung tumors

The incidence of lung cancer has been high in recent years, and it is also very harmful to patients. Through investigation, it was found that people who smoke all year round have the highest incidence of lung cancer. Lung cancer should be treated in time. If it is early lung cancer, the treatment effect is generally very good. However, if it is discovered late, it will often increase the difficulty of treatment and pose a great threat to the patient's life safety. There are many treatments for lung cancer, the more common ones are radiotherapy, chemotherapy, and surgical therapy, etc. In addition, traditional Chinese medicine treatment and lifestyle treatment are also common supportive therapies.

1. Radiotherapy: Radiotherapy can alleviate the symptoms of 70% of patients with advanced lung cancer. External radiotherapy with different doses and fractions can relieve local symptoms of primary or metastatic lesions. However, patients with advanced lung cancer often die prematurely due to the strong toxic side effects and complications of radiotherapy. While enduring the torture of cancer, they also have to endure the toxic side effects of treatments such as radiotherapy, such as chest pain, nausea, vomiting, hair loss, fatigue, etc., and their quality of life is extremely poor.

2. Surgical treatment of lung cancer: Although surgery can remove lesions in the lungs, due to the poor physical condition and low immunity of patients with advanced lung cancer, surgery often causes serious damage to their vitality and a sharp decline in their quality of life. If systemic treatment is not carried out, the good results are often short-lived, leading to tumor recurrence or metastasis, especially for small cell lung cancer.

3. Chemotherapy for lung cancer: Small cell lung cancer progresses rapidly, has a strong tendency to spread throughout the body, and is highly sensitive to chemotherapy. The 5-year survival rate has increased from 1% to over 10%. Therefore, chemotherapy has become a major treatment for small cell lung cancer. Excessively aggressive treatment not only fails to prolong survival, but also reduces the patient's quality of life, aggravates the symptoms of patients with advanced lung cancer, and causes unbearable pain.

4. Biological therapy: Tumor biological therapy is the fourth treatment mode after surgery, radiotherapy and chemotherapy. It has the potential to turn cancer into a manageable, chronic disease. Tumor biotherapy (autologous cell immunotherapy) combined with surgery, chemotherapy and radiotherapy can effectively improve the effect of cancer treatment.
